Bill Summary

Retirement Savings Transparency Act of 2009 - Amends the Employee Retirement Income Security Act of 1974 (ERISA) to require, for calendar quarters beginning on or after January 1, 2010, pension benefit statements of individual account plans which permit a participant or beneficiary to direct the investment of plan assets to include appropriate and consistent points of comparison (including differences between classes and types of investments)...

(Source: Library of Congress)
